Degree Programme Quality Assurance Committee (QA Committee)
This Committee is required by the University’s Quality Assurance System and is also referenced in the “Operating Rules of Degree Programmes at the University of Bologna.”
Composition
The Committee is chaired by the Degree Programme Director and includes lecturers who are members of the Degree Programme Board. Student representatives elected to the Board also participate in the Committee or, if none are elected, students enrolled in the programme who are appointed by the Board.

Functions
The Committee supports the Degree Programme Director in managing quality assurance procedures and promoting a culture of quality.
Degree programmes conduct self-assessments by analysing and monitoring their performance based on student feedback and specific indicators.
The activities must have measurable and documented outcomes. The self-assessment process facilitates the flow of information and knowledge management, also promoting transparency in the decision-making process and its implementation.
The documents produced by the QA Committee are designed to support discussions within the Degree Programme Board and with the Joint Student-Teacher Committee (Commissione Paritetica Docenti-Studenti), which operates within the Department to which the Degree Programme belongs.
Similarly to the Degree Programme Quality Assurance Committee, the Joint Committee plays a role in quality assurance procedures and in fostering a culture of quality.
